# H. Res. 196 — what changed

H. Res. 196, Supporting the Sixth Amendment to the United States Constitution, the right to counsel. — 1 section amended between Introduced in House and Reported in House.

Edits are marked `<del>struck</del>` and `<ins>inserted</ins>`.

## (unnamed section)

- That the House of Representatives—
- (1) [was (1)] supports the Sixth Amendment to the United States Constitution, the right to counsel; and
- (2) [was (2)] supports strategies to improve the criminal justice system to ensure that indigent defendants in all felony cases are adequately represented by counsel.
